R. Sanders Williams is a scholar working on Molecular Biology, Cardiology and Cardiovascular Medicine and Physiology. According to data from OpenAlex, R. Sanders Williams has authored 133 papers receiving a total of 13.1k indexed citations (citations by other indexed papers that have themselves been cited), including 100 papers in Molecular Biology, 31 papers in Cardiology and Cardiovascular Medicine and 26 papers in Physiology. Recurrent topics in R. Sanders Williams’s work include Muscle Physiology and Disorders (38 papers), Mitochondrial Function and Pathology (24 papers) and Adipose Tissue and Metabolism (21 papers). R. Sanders Williams is often cited by papers focused on Muscle Physiology and Disorders (38 papers), Mitochondrial Function and Pathology (24 papers) and Adipose Tissue and Metabolism (21 papers). R. Sanders Williams collaborates with scholars based in United States, United Kingdom and Canada. R. Sanders Williams's co-authors include Rhonda Bassel‐Duby, Eric N. Olson, John M. Shelton, Zhen Yan, James A. Richardson, Haiyan Wu, Beverly A. Rothermel, Ivor J. Benjamin, Rick B. Vega and Quan Yang and has published in prestigious journals such as Nature, Science and Cell.
